WebYour Brakes’ Anatomy Today, cars universally use hydraulics to apply the brakes. When you press the pedal, a plunger depresses in the master cylinder, moving the pressurized fluid. The fluid’s increase pressure moves through the brake lines and compresses each wheel’s cylinder. WebNov 17, 2008 · The brake caliper fits over the rotor like a clamp. Inside each caliper is a pair of metal plates bonded with friction material -- these are called brake pads. The outboard brake pads are on the outside of the …
